The Main Street Capital Access Act, HR6955, significantly deregulates the banking sector, promoting new bank formation, streamlining regulatory processes, and easing capital requirements for financial institutions. This directly increases lending capacity and profitability for both large and small banks, as well as fintech companies that partner with banks. The bill's passage out of committee indicates high legislative momentum.

This bill significantly increases asset thresholds for regulatory oversight from $10 billion to $50 billion, directly reducing compliance costs and increasing operational flexibility for regional banks. This regulatory relief immediately boosts profitability for financial institutions with assets between these thresholds. The bill is sponsored by Rep. Barr, a Republican from Kentucky, indicating strong legislative intent.
